- From a small shop in Delhi to a presence across major cities in India. What were the difficult moments during this transition?
We started as a small shop in Lajpat Rai Market in Delhi where we used to deal with earphones and mobile accessories in our shop. While working in the wholesale business, we noticed that there was a gap in the products available in the market in terms of price, quality, and reliability it offers. So, to eliminate cheap accessories from the Indian market, we came up with our own brand, ‘UBON’ with our main focus on providing our customers with quality products at affordable pricing.

- How does this industry of consumer electronics shaping up?
The consumer electronics and accessories market in India has seen an upward graph in the past decade. With the advent of faster internet connections and new technologies, this consumption of mobile phone accessories will upsurge in the future. Growing smartphone penetration gave a major push to the Accessories Market in India. After China, India contributes majorly to the development of the Mobile Phone Market globally. Currently, more than 90 percent of the mobile components are imported in India and the segment relies heavily on shipments from China and Taiwan for handsets. The Government under its Make in India initiative aims to reform this by encouraging local manufacturing, with incentives, etc. With the Government’s support in a phased approach, the sector has gone through a huge transformation.

- How do you utilize both offline and online channels? What’s the major difference between the two?
UBON has a robust supply chain network which enables it to distribute its products all over India basis the distribution network level available in every state. To make UBON available everywhere, we are putting our faith in offline channels more than online channels. Interestingly, in our research, we found that people prefer to try and physically feel the product before making a buying decision. This consumer behavior pattern led us to develop eye-catchy products and premium as well. We have also collaborated with leading online marketplaces such as Amazon, Snapdeal, and Flipkart to reach the masses. UBON has mastered the retail chain network across India and can be found in the majority of shops and showrooms in the country.
